Channel 4, in collaboration with eBay, has announced an exciting new series set to premiere later this year. Produced by Plum Pictures and Imhotep Productions, the 4 part show will feature rapper Tinie and F1 analyst and stunt driver Naomi Schiff exploring the resurgence of cars from the 70s, 80s, and 90s. Models like the Ford Sierra Cosworth, Peugeot 205 GTI, and Citroen Saxo, which were once everyday vehicles, are now coveted by enthusiasts and fetching high prices at auctions. Tinie and Naomi have dubbed them ‘Bangers.’

Each episode will focus on a different car category, including hatchbacks, sports cars, 4x4s, and family cars. The hosts will engage in a friendly competition called the ‘Battle of the Bangers,’ where they will determine the best car in each class. With the assistance of car enthusiasts across the UK, Tinie and Naomi will explore the performance, history, culture, and iconic status of each vehicle. The series will culminate in a final challenge to determine the ultimate winner.
